Understanding Large US Company Stocks
Large US company stocks are shares of publicly-traded companies with a market capitalization of over $10 billion. These companies are typically leaders in their respective industries and have a proven track record of success. Some of the most well-known large US companies include Apple, Microsoft, and Johnson & Johnson.
Stability and Dividends
One of the main advantages of investing in large US company stocks is their stability. These companies have been around for decades, weathering various economic storms and emerging stronger. This stability is reflected in their dividend yields, which are typically higher than those of smaller companies. Dividends are a portion of a company's profits distributed to shareholders, providing investors with a regular income stream.
Growth Potential
Despite their size, large US companies often have significant growth potential. Many of these companies are global leaders, expanding their market presence and exploring new business opportunities. Apple and Microsoft are prime examples. They have not only maintained their dominance in their respective industries but have also ventured into new markets, such as health technology and cloud computing.
Market Diversification
Investing in large US company stocks can also help diversify your portfolio. These companies operate in various industries, reducing the risk of being affected by market fluctuations in a single sector. For instance, if the technology industry experiences a downturn, your portfolio may still be protected by investments in other sectors represented by large US companies.
Case Studies
To illustrate the potential of large US company stocks, let's look at two case studies:
Apple Inc.
Apple, a $2.5 trillion company, has consistently delivered strong financial performance. Its products, including the iPhone, iPad, and MacBook, have become global symbols of innovation and quality. Apple has also been a reliable dividend payer, increasing its dividend every year since 2012. Investors who bought Apple stock in 2010 have seen their investment grow by over 1,000%.
Microsoft Corporation

Microsoft, another $2.3 trillion company, has transformed itself from a software giant to a leader in cloud computing. Its Azure platform has gained significant market share, driving the company's growth. Microsoft has also been a reliable dividend payer, offering investors a consistent income stream.
